TRAINING CORPORATE SOCIAL RESPONSIBILITY: SHORT COURSES THE IMPORTANCE OF CORPORATE SOCIAL RESPONSIBILITY CSR is a burning developmental issue in South Africa and must form part of the strategic plan of each company. Different legislative and policy frameworks are also in place to regulate the various industries from a national level. The underlying motive for CSR is to regulate the corporate world to act as a good corporate citizen along the lines of the three basic dimensions of development, namely the economic, the environmental and the social sphere. Good CSR practices aligned with international best practices in this regard will definitely enhance sustainability in our country as well as in the rest of the continent.
